Writing Assignments 
Was the students able to identify characters and events within the two texts. Where students able to identify when their thinking started to change. Were students able to provide evidence from the text.

Content & Development

Excellent

- Content is comprehensive, accurate, and persuasive
- Major points are stated clearly and are well supported.
- Evidence made when referencing the text.
- Content and purpose of the writing are clear.
Good

- Content is complete, but not accurate.
- Some of the Major points are clear and /or persuasive.
- Some evidence were made when referencing the text.
- Content and purpose is somewhat clear.
Fair

- Content is not comprehensive and /or persuasive.
- Major points are addressed, but not well supported.
- Research is inadequate or does not address course concepts.
- Content is inconsistent with regard to purpose and clarity of thought.
Organization & Structure

Excellent

- Structure of the paper is clear and easy to follow.
- Introduction provides sufficient background on the topic and previews major points.
- Sentences starters were used.
- Paragraph transitions are present and logical and maintain the flow of thought throughout the paper.
- Conclusion is logical and flows from the body of the paper.
Good

- Organization and structure detract from the message of the writing task.
- Introduction and/or conclusion is missing.
- Sentences starters not used.
- Paragraphs are disjointed and lack transition of thoughts.
Fair

- Structure of the paper is not easy to follow.
- Introduction is missing or, if provided, does not preview major points.
- Paragraph transitions need improvement.
- No sentence starters.
- Conclusion is missing, or if provided, does not flow from the body of the paper.
Format

Excellent

- Paper follows designated guidelines.
- Paper is the appropriate length as described for the assignment.
Good

- Paper lacks some elements of correct formatting.
- Paper is inadequate or excessive in length.
Fair

- Paper follows most guidelines.
- Paper provides reference list, with some errors or omissions.
- Paper is over/ under word length.
- Not in Essay format.
Grammar, Punctuation & Spelling

Excellent

- Rules of grammar, usage, and punctuation are followed; spelling is correct.- Language is clear and precise; sentences display consistently strong, varied structure.
Good

- Paper contains some grammatical, punctuation, and spelling errors.-Language uses some unclear sentences and structures.
Fair

- Paper contains numerous grammatical, punctuation and spelling errors. Language lacks clarity or includes the use of some jargon or conversational tone.
